I took the trouble of getting the action plan and going through it. Because it was so general I asked a specific question about the Department of Rural and Community Development but unfortunately the question is general across all Departments. It was not my intention to ask that question. I asked specifically about the planned projects under the remit of the Department of Rural and Community Development. I read page 47, which mentions social enterprise, senior alert schemes, new volunteer centres and young social innovators. These are all very worthy but I cannot explain to anybody in Galway city or county what projects are going ahead next year or how we can make it easier for them in terms of access. I am thinking in particular of the organisation about which I wrote to the Minister of State with regard to autism. I will not go into the details. It is crying out for money. According to the Comptroller and Auditor General there is an underspend and we seem to have a very complicated system. I think the Minister of State is nodding in agreement, which is welcome, but we really need to push this forward so we can use the money.
